## Authentication

Proselint-Q, our documentation linter, checks style rules against the central rulebook service rather than shipping rules locally, so every run needs to authenticate. New team members should request access through the #docs-tooling channel; approval usually takes a day. CI pipelines already have a shared credential injected at build time, so you only need your own key for local runs. Keys are scoped read-only and rotate every 90 days — the linter will warn you a week before expiry. Your local development key goes below.

service key, fawip-bajef: kto11_Qt5wZK9vdNC

HANDOVER NOTE — Director Transition, Warranty Program

For branch managers: warranty costs on the Taverner line ran 18% over budget this year, driven by a supplier defect in the hinge assembly. Corrective sourcing from Ellwick Components begins next month. Claims processing stays unchanged. My successor will review reserve levels in the first thirty days. Forward plans are outlined in the confidential note below.

board note of kajeg-bahof: Holdorix Works plans to lower the Briius list price by 11.6 percent in September. The pricing group signed off on a budget of $499.9 million for Project Holdor. The renewal with Fraokix Group closes at $129.5 million a year, 50.2 percent above the last contract. Project Tameth slips by one quarter because of the tooling delay.

Handover for new starters: the mail room has moved from the ground floor of Tarnley House to Room B2 in the annexe. All incoming post now arrives there by 09:30, and outgoing trays must be down by 15:00 sharp. Parcels for the third floor still get logged in the blue book first. The old room is now storage — don't leave anything there. The B2 door code is below.

staff pass of kawip-hawef = bdg-QLP-2